Grade 2 - Enrichment *Typing
REMEMBER: Focus on knowing where letters are located on the keyboard. Practice proper finger placement and accuracy, not speed. Put your fingers on home row trying to strike the keys with the correct fingers. Speed will be acquired over time in the future months and years of typing lessons as proper typing technique is practiced and developed.
